Abstract | ||
This research is aim to: 1- Develop a scale of psychological pollution of the students of kindergarten department. 2- Measure the psychological pollution of the students of kindergarten department . The population is limited by(678) students of kindergarten department in both of college of the basic education Mustansiriyah university & college of women education Baghdad university in the year 2014-2015. The sample of the research is consist of (120) students as a statistical analysis sample & (402) students to measure the psychological pollution of the students of kindergarten department. The researcher depended on (Mohammed 2004) scale – which measures the psychological pollution of the students of Mousel university – to verify the first aim, but the researcher has developed the scale to adopt it to the students of kindergarten department, so she has added items ,amended items , deleted others & kept items from the origin scale in each part of the origin scale ,in addition the researcher has amended the name of the third part from womanishness to womanishness & mannish . The scale became consist of (124) items .The validity of the scale is got by two methods face validity & construct validity (item discrimination) , also got the reliability of the scale by test –retest method & alpha Cronbach method. To verify the second aim the researcher has applied the scale on (402) students . After analysis the results its shown that there is no statistical significant of psychological pollution ,but it also shown that there is 40% of the students have psychological pollution & its not a good indicators . The researcher recommended the officials to be aware of this subject & make counseling symposiums related with the ethics of kindergarten teacher & emphasized on the media role. | ||
